Pentagon Spokesperson General Patrick Ryder evaluated the developments in the Middle East at the daily press conference.

Ryder shared the information that between October 17-24, at least 10 separate attacks were carried out on US and coalition forces with un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) and rockets in Iraq and 3 separate attacks in Syria.

Stating that they know that the groups that organized the attacks are supported by the Iranian regime and the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C), Ryder said, “We see the possibility of a more serious escalation in the near future from Iran’s proxy forces and ultimately against US forces and personnel across the region coming from Iran.” he said.

In response to a question about the 3 missiles fired towards Israel by the Houthis in Yemen on October 19, Ryder shared the information that the range of these missiles was around 2 thousand kilometers and evaluated that they could probably have reached Israel if they had not been shot down by USS Carney.

INTERVENTION TO MISSILES LAUNCHED FROM YEMEN

The Pentagon announced that it intervened in 3 missiles launched from Yemen across the Red Sea towards Israel on October 19.

It was noted that the missiles, which were said to have been launched by the Houthis, were shot down by the USS Carney warship operating in the region because they were “perceived as a potential threat”, and it was stated that the targets of the missiles were not known for certain. (AA)
